Hi all

I found a domain name and hosting company offering a deal to web designers that they will provide free domain names and hosting for sites if the designer does the site for free.

Then both parties take a profit share.

ive emailed them for more info, but id like to know if anyone has come across an offer like this before and if there are any possible pitfalls with it.

Im not going to touch it if i cant retain ownership and control of the sites i design, but on the whole it seems not too bad an idea.

Any thoughts?

I'll offer you that... domains cost what £5 .co.uk for two years hosting fee's runs to what on average £60 - £120 pa. (psst we have our own servers and fibreline)

HOW MUCH TO DESIGN A SITE !

The work and time involved in creating a site way out ranks the costs for domain/hosting.
